What is the Recipes Plugin add-on?

RECIPES ADD-ON is a powerful Minecraft plugin that give you the possibility to make any custom recipe for any item and edit these recipes. This plugin requires the FREE EventEngine plugin.

What You Need Before Installing

  • Minecraft Java Edition Server: EVENT ENGINE is compatible with Paper and Folia server software versions 1.20 to 1.21.8.
  • Access to Server Files: You’ll need the ability to upload files to your server, typically via FTP or a file manager provided by your hosting service.
  • Luckperms (Optional): this plugin uses permissions

Installation Guide

⚠️ Event Engine is a free plugin available for everyone. In contradiction to all of our other plugins, you are free to share this plugin. You are NOT allowed to share any add-ons you buy for the event engine with other people.

  1. Download the FREE Event Engine Plugin. Go to the official dowload page on PhytorMC – DOWNLOAD EVENT ENGINE >
  2. Download the Recipes Add-on from our website  – DOWNLOAD RECIPES ADD-ON >
  3. Locate the Plugins folder in your server files and drag the EventEngine.jar and the RecipesAddon.jar into the folder. 
  4. Restart the server and the add-on will now be enabled (Add-ons won’t work without EventEngine)

List of commands

⚠️ SideNote: for players to be able to use /recipes, you need to give them the permission ‘eventengine.recipes’

/ee recipes broadcast <true/false>
broadcast when a weapon, tool or stuff like that is crafted only, not items or blocks

/ee recipes craftonce <true/false>
can craft each recipe 1 time

/ee recipes create <new-name> <slot (starting at 9 ending at 44)
will then open a gui add recipes in their right slot and result in the result slot, then close that gui and it will be created

/ee recipes remove <name>
deletes a recipe

/ee recipes view <name>
view a recipe, but better to use /recipes command

⚠️ SideNote: for players to be able to use /recipes, you need to give them the permission ‘eventengine.recipes’

/recipes <name>
view all or one recipe(s)
